What it does

The NDPA functions as an umbrella organisation for local police forces disabled staff associations. We act as a point of reference and consultation point for our members, Home Office, ACPO,NPIA, APA and all stakeholders. We sign post to serving officers, staff, potential recruits and members of the public who have an interest or issues re disability issues and rights
